Why each option
International projects face significant challenges due to differences in time zones, increased travel costs, and language barriers, all of which can severely impede successful completion.
Different time zones significantly complicate scheduling meetings, real-time collaboration, and establishing consistent working hours across international teams, leading to communication delays.
International travel costs can quickly escalate, impacting project budgets and potentially limiting essential face-to-face interactions or site visits necessary for successful project execution.
Co-location of resources is often a benefit for project efficiency, not an inherent adverse impact; its absence might be a challenge, but co-location itself is not negative.
While a poor project plan can have an adverse impact, 'The project plan' itself is a tool for success, not an inherent challenge unique to international projects.
Scheduled vacations are a normal part of any project and, while they require planning, are not a significant adverse impact unique to international projects compared to the other options.
Language barriers impede clear communication among international team members, stakeholders, and vendors, leading to misunderstandings, errors, and delays in project progress.
